Tour description

The midday tour will start from the Pigalle area, and snake its way through the Montmartre streets and alleyways to highlight its history and its association with the impressionist painters.

While gradually walking up to the summit of the Montmartre hill, I'll be showing the best cafes with views, the locations of the famous artist's ateliers, interesting architectural features of the 'village' part of Montmartre, and other more recent artistic curiosities of 20th century Montmartre.
To save time, we'll not be entering the two Montmartre museums or the churches. But passing in front of them, I'll give a short presentation about each of them.
This tour will give you a good experience and feel of what Montmartre is all about, so you can claim to have visited this famous neighborhood.
The tour will also give you advice on what else to see, especially the interior of various buildings of touristic interest. So join me on this tour!
